Optimizing Break Time Images for SEO
To fully leverage the benefits of Break Time Images, it's essential to optimize them for search engines. Here are some best practices:
- File Names: Use descriptive file names that include relevant keywords. For example, instead of "image1.jpg," use "break-time-images-tips.jpg."
- Alt Text: Include alt text that describes the image and includes relevant keywords. This not only helps with SEO but also improves accessibility for visually impaired users.
- Image Size: Compress images to reduce file size without compromising quality. Large images can slow down page load times, negatively impacting user experience and SEO.
- Responsive Design: Ensure images are responsive and adapt to different screen sizes and devices. This enhances the user experience across all platforms.
